1. YouTube: The $41 B+ Growth Engine
Q3 2025 Ads Revenue: $10.3 B (+15 % YoY)
Annual Run Rate: $41 B+ — Larger than Netflix’s total revenue
YouTube remains Alphabet’s most consistent and diversified growth pillar—spanning short-form, connected TV, and live events. The platform has crossed a structural threshold: video monetization is now margin-positive across all formats.
Strategic Breakthroughs
- Shorts Monetization Surpasses Traditional
In the U.S., YouTube Shorts now generate more revenue per watch hour than standard in-stream ads. AI-optimized targeting and unified auctions between formats allow Alphabet to monetize attention without fragmenting ad inventory. - Connected TV Dominance
YouTube is #1 in the living room for over two years (Nielsen), capturing a rising share of linear-TV ad budgets. The platform’s integration into smart-TV ecosystems turns YouTube into the default television interface for a generation of cord-cutters. - Global Live Scale
The NFL broadcast with 19 M+ concurrent viewers set a new record, proving YouTube’s ability to handle television-scale events with digital precision.
Strategic Implications
YouTube sits at the intersection of culture, distribution, and commerce. Its content graph feeds Alphabet’s recommendation systems, while Shorts’ data density enhances Gemini’s video understanding.
Economically, YouTube represents Alphabet’s most defensible consumer property in the age of AI agents. Video remains intrinsically human—experiential, contextual, and emotional—qualities that resist automation and commodification.
2. Subscriptions, Platforms & Devices: Recurring Resilience
Q3 2025 Revenue: $12.9 B (+21 % YoY)
300 M+ Paid Subscriptions — Fastest-growing Alphabet segment
This segment has evolved from a strategic hedge into a primary growth vector. Alphabet’s subscription flywheel—spanning YouTube Premium, YouTube TV, Google Play/One, and hardware—converts attention into durable recurring revenue.
Portfolio Composition
- YouTube Premium & Music – the largest contributor, benefiting from Shorts discovery and bundling.
- YouTube TV – a scaled CTV subscription anchored by NFL rights and expanding local content.
- Google Play / One – cloud storage, device backup, and Gemini-enhanced AI tools driving ARPU uplift.
- Pixel 10 (Tensor G5 + Gemini) – vertical integration of AI-native hardware.
- Android XR (w/ Samsung) – entry into spatial computing as the next interface layer.
Structural Economics
Subscriptions deliver margin accretion: fixed infrastructure costs decline relative to expanding user lifetime value. AI integration (Gemini suggestions, smart editing, predictive recommendations) reduces churn while raising perceived utility.
Strategic Flywheel
Hardware is not primarily a profit driver—it’s a distribution vector. Every Pixel or XR device extends the Gemini environment, feeding back into usage, data, and subscription renewal.
This interplay between devices and services creates predictable top-line expansion with ecosystem reinforcement—a design reminiscent of Apple’s hardware-software synergy, but rooted in AI utility rather than design aspiration.
3. Chrome: The AI-Powered Browser
Control Point for Billions of Users
Chrome, once considered mature, is being reborn as the operating layer for agentic workflows. Its significance in the AI era lies not in page rendering but in intent mediation.
The AI Transformation Underway
- Deep Gemini Integration — turning the address bar into a reasoning interface.
- Native AI Mode in Search — embedding conversational results within the browser itself.
- Agentic Capabilities — Chrome will orchestrate user workflows across web, email, and productivity apps.
- Search Box → Intent OS — the browser becomes the gateway for agent coordination, not just content retrieval.
Strategic Function
In a landscape of proliferating AI agents, Chrome remains the dominant access layer to the web. It’s Alphabet’s insurance against external intermediaries—preserving data access, default status, and behavioral telemetry.
By integrating Gemini directly into the browser, Alphabet ensures that even as users move toward conversational or task-based interfaces, Google remains the ambient intelligence routing those interactions.
This makes Chrome both an AI delivery channel and a defensive fortress against platform erosion.
